Reel Options® Adds New Manufacturing and Testing Equipment


Reel Options® has been busing adding new equipment for production and testing. A second spin welding assembly station has recently been set up due to increased production of the 6.5 inch and 10.5 inch utility spools. The new station will also accommodate an all new 12 inch flange that is currently in the final testing phase. The spin welding process bonds the plastic flanges to the plastic extruded core creating a strong bond without the need for adhesives, staples or bolts. Both the flanges and the cores are manufactured in-house using reprocessed materials to create an economical and environmentally friendly product.

Reel Options has also purchased a new pull tester that is used for in-process testing of assembled reels to assure consistency of our manufacturing and assembly techniques. The pull tester has been instrumental for the R&D team as well in developing new products, such as the new 12 inch spin welded flange. By being able to test in-house Reel Options has been able to bring product from concept to production much quicker and at considerably lower development cost.
